Suicide Bombing at Darul Uloom Haqqania Claims Six Lives, Including JUI-S Chief.


Six persons have been killed in a devastating suicide explosion at Darul Uloom Haqqania in the Akora Khattak neighborhood of Nowshera, including Maulana Hamidul Haq Haqqani, the leader of Jamiat Ulema-e-Islam-Sami (JUI-S). More than a dozen people received injuries as well in the February 28, 2025, incident that took place after Friday services. During prayers, an attacker broke through a side gate and targeted the mosque, which is part of the religious school’s grounds. After the casualties were quickly taken to local hospitals by rescue crews, forensic and security teams started their investigations.

 

According to reports, the main target was Maulana Hamidul Haq Haqqani, the son of the late Maulana Samiul Haq Haqqani, who is regarded as the “spiritual father of the Taliban.” The safety of Pakistani religious establishments has been under scrutiny following the 2018 assassination of his father. Even mosques and seminaries are no longer secure, according to the JUI-S spokesperson, who condemned the attack.

 

Khyber-Pakhtunkhwa Governor Faisal Karim Kundi described the attack as a “conspiracy of hostile forces” and condemned the provincial government for its security management. Interior Minister Mohsin Naqvi, President Asif Ali Zardari, and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if have expressed their condolences to the families of the victims and strongly condemned the explosion.

 

This tragedy comes after several mosque attacks in the area, such as the Peshawar Police Lines explosion in January 2023, which claimed over 100 lives. The Islamic State group was held responsible for the massacres, which was also denounced by the Taliban regime in Afghanistan.
